- Winter Lecture Series – Celebrating HMML’s 60 Years — The Extraordinary, Ordinary Work of Building a Digital Library
- Topic
- How do you preserve and share manuscripts? How do you start with a fragile physical book, transform it into carefully maintained digital images, and then provide free, round-the-clock access to it for anyone, anywhere in the world? How do you make sure people can find one text among hundreds of thousands? What are the challenges—and how do you overcome them? The HMML team will consider these questions and more, offering a rare glimpse of their work—and why it matters.
- Presenter
- John Meyerhofer, Director of Information Systems; Wayne Torborg, Director of Digital Collections & Imaging; Dr. Catherine Walsh, Director of Cataloging & Library Services
